Riding into the Sunrise by Gregory Yeoman
A small group of cyclists from Britain, Australia and Russia, head off on a cycling adventure across Russia. From St. Petersburg and 8,300 miles and 5 months later, to Vladivostok. A fantastic read that will make you want to ride into your own sunrise.
